"Difficult conversations" refers to conversations that involve sensitive topics, challenging issues, or uncomfortable situations that can be hard to talk about openly and honestly. These discussions may involve conflict, emotional tension, or potential disagreements, requiring extra care and sensitivity to navigate effectively. Full definition
